If you're not an Rpg fan than i'd go with the saboteur. Dragon age is HEAVY on the Rpg-ness and will take a while just to fully understand how the systems work.
 
It doesn't have that much in common with Oblivion besides the whole exploring sidequests thing. The combat is drastically different. Combat wise it has more in common with Final Fantasy12.

Did you play Mass Effect or the KOTOR games? What did you think of the massive amounts of dialog? If you hated it, then I don't think DA:O will be a winner for you. But if you have nothing against chatting up npc's and you like all the traditional things an RPG offers, plus a good story, then go for it. I'd say you talk more than fight in DA:O. 
 
The Sabouter: WWII GTA. 
 
I think you'll spend a lot of hours with both games. So... what are you looking for? Swords and bows or rifles and machine guns? A serious game or a not so serious one?

Did you like or play KOTOR? The games are essentially the same, with Dragon Age having an improved Tactics system which is useful for commanding your squad, along with less flashier combat. As far as story itself, it's OK but the Bioware presentation is what makes it what it is. The story and setting is very similar to Lord of the Rings. I have a feeling if you don't like RPGs you may not like this game.
